Ordered that the order is affirmed, with costs.

The plaintiff commenced this action to recover damages for personal injuries. The plaintiff testified at a General Municipal Law § 50-h hearing and his deposition that he slipped and fell while descending a staircase to an underground subway station on January 23, 2016.
